What does an educational consultant do?

Educational consultants do many things. They advise K-12 school districts on how to integrate technology into the classroom. They design and manage higher education and professional development programs for K-12 teachers at universities and colleges. And they help companies design products for teachers.

What do educational consultants charge?

Independent educational consultant fees are about $200 per hour on average. Although, some consultants charge as low as $85 per hour. Most clients purchase service packages, which range anywhere from $850 to $10,000, depending on what the package includes and the consultant’s experience.

What degree is needed to be a consultant?

Consultants usually hold degrees in business administration, finance or economics. However, degrees in psychology, marketing and computer science are common as well among business consultants. To work in a particular industry, consider a minor in that field in addition to a business degree.

How do I become an educational consultant?

To become an Education Consultant, you will need at least a bachelor’s degree and some institutions require a master’s degree. While it can be helpful to get your degree in a relevant field like education or cognitive science , education consultants come from all kinds of backgrounds.

What is the role of an education consultant?

An educational consultant basically works as academic advisor. In most cases they are independent advisors; that is to say that they usually work on freelance basis. Their job description entails helping educational institutions and schools, and in some cases parents and students, in solving problems that are education-related.
